Cloud Adoption Roadmap Guide for Growing Firms

A cloud project rarely fails because an organisation chose the wrong platform. More often, it fails because critical systems were moved before the business had agreed what success looked like, who owned the risk, or how costs would be controlled. A practical cloud adoption roadmap guide gives growing organisations a clearer route forward: one that improves resilience and flexibility without creating disruption, security gaps or an open-ended monthly bill.

For UK businesses with lean internal IT teams, cloud adoption should not be treated as a single migration event. It is a business change programme that affects people, processes, data, security and continuity. The right approach makes technology easier to manage while giving leaders better confidence in their ability to support growth.

Start with business outcomes, not cloud services

Before discussing virtual machines, storage tiers or subscription licences, establish the outcomes the organisation needs from cloud adoption. A business expanding into new locations may need staff to access systems securely from anywhere. A professional services firm may be focused on improving disaster recovery. A manufacturer might need more reliable access to data across sites, while a growing company may simply be tired of buying server capacity years before it is needed.

These priorities shape the roadmap. They also help prevent a common mistake: moving everything to the cloud because it appears modern, rather than because it solves a defined operational problem.

Set a small number of measurable objectives. For example, reduce recovery time after an outage, support secure hybrid working, retire ageing hardware, improve visibility of IT spend, or make a customer-facing application more reliable. Each objective should have an owner, a target date and a way to measure progress.

Cloud is not automatically cheaper in every circumstance. It can reduce capital expenditure and remove maintenance burden, but poorly governed consumption can increase operating costs. The strongest business case considers the total cost of ownership, including licences, connectivity, security, backup, support, training and migration effort.

Build the facts before building the plan

A reliable roadmap begins with a detailed assessment of the existing environment. This is not merely an asset list. It should show how systems depend on each other, where data is held, who uses each application, what would happen if it were unavailable, and whether it is suitable for cloud hosting.

Many organisations find that their environment is more interconnected than expected. An accounting package may rely on an on-premise file share. A line-of-business application may require a particular database version. A legacy system may be business-critical but no longer supported by its vendor. Moving one component without understanding these dependencies can create downtime that affects the whole business.

The assessment should cover infrastructure, applications, users, data, network capacity, identity management, backup arrangements and contractual obligations. It should also identify security weaknesses such as shared administrator accounts, inconsistent multi-factor authentication, unsupported operating systems and unclear data retention policies.

This stage is a good opportunity to separate systems into sensible categories. Some applications can move with minimal change. Others should be modernised, replaced with software-as-a-service, retained on existing infrastructure for now, or retired altogether. The goal is not to force every workload into one model. A hybrid environment is often the sensible answer, especially where specialist equipment, legacy applications or performance requirements remain on site.

The cloud adoption roadmap guide: six decisions to make

A cloud plan becomes useful when it turns broad ambition into decisions that teams can act on. The following six decisions provide a practical framework.

1. Choose the right operating model. Decide whether public cloud, private cloud, software-as-a-service or a hybrid approach best suits each workload. A hybrid model can provide a measured transition for organisations that cannot, or should not, move every system at once.

2. Set security and governance standards early. Agree how identities will be managed, who can approve new services, how privileged access is controlled, where data can reside and how activity will be monitored. Security controls designed after migration are usually more costly and less effective.

3. Define resilience requirements. Establish acceptable recovery time and recovery point objectives for each critical system. A backup is not the same as a tested recovery plan. The business needs to know how quickly it can restore services and how much data it can afford to lose.

4. Create a cost-control model. Assign ownership for cloud spend, use budgets and alerts, and review consumption regularly. Rightsizing, reserved capacity and removing unused resources can make a meaningful difference, but only if someone is accountable for reviewing them.

5. Prioritise migration waves. Start with lower-risk workloads that will demonstrate value without putting core operations at risk. Use each migration wave to refine the process before moving more complex or business-critical systems.

6. Plan for day-two operations. Decide who will monitor performance, apply patches, manage access requests, respond to incidents and test recovery. Migration is only the start of the service lifecycle.

Put security and continuity at the centre

Cloud providers secure the underlying platform, but customers remain responsible for how they configure services, manage identities, protect data and control access. This shared responsibility model is frequently misunderstood, particularly when businesses assume that a cloud-hosted system is automatically protected against every form of loss or cyber attack.

A sound roadmap should include multi-factor authentication, least-privilege access, endpoint protection, centralised logging and regular patching. It should also consider encryption, data classification and the needs of staff working from offices, home locations and client sites.

Cyber resilience requires more than preventative controls. Ransomware, accidental deletion and supplier outages can all affect cloud services. Keep recoverable copies of critical data, test restorations, document incident responsibilities and ensure key contacts understand the escalation process. The best recovery plan is one that has been rehearsed under realistic conditions, not one that only exists in a folder.

For regulated businesses, data sovereignty and retention requirements may affect the choice of service and location. Legal, compliance and operational teams should be involved early, particularly where personal data, financial information or client-sensitive records are concerned.

Migrate in controlled stages

A phased migration reduces risk and gives users time to adapt. Begin with a pilot workload that has clear success criteria and manageable dependencies. This could be a collaboration platform, a non-critical application or a development environment. The pilot should test not only the technology but also user experience, support processes, network performance and security controls.

Once the pilot is stable, move through planned waves. Each wave needs a migration runbook, a tested rollback plan, clear downtime communication and post-migration validation. Do not assume that an application is working simply because it opens. Confirm integrations, permissions, printing, reporting, performance and backup status before closing the change.

User communication matters more than many technical teams expect. Staff need to know what is changing, when it will happen, how it will affect their routine and where they can get help. Short, practical guidance is usually more effective than a large training pack sent at the last minute.

It is also worth allowing time for optimisation after each wave. Cloud environments need tuning. Resources may need resizing, access policies may need adjustment, and teams may identify processes that can be simplified once systems are no longer tied to a particular office or server room.

Measure value after go-live

A roadmap should continue beyond the final migration date. Track the outcomes agreed at the beginning: availability, recovery performance, security incidents, support volumes, user satisfaction and cost against budget. These measures show whether cloud adoption is delivering the operational improvements the business expected.

Review the environment regularly to identify unused resources, changing capacity needs and new security risks. As the organisation grows, the right cloud design will change too. A platform that is appropriate for 50 users may need different controls, support arrangements and resilience measures when it supports 250 users across several locations.
